Retirement Plan Relationship Manager - Adcock Financial Group

Primary Responsibilities

  • Manage day to day relationships for a book of 401(k) and 403(b) retirement plan clients
  • Coordinate and participate in client review meetings, investment committee meetings and DCIO partner meetings
  • Aid corporate clients with plan administration questions, service requests and ongoing support
  • Work closely with recordkeepers, TPAs, custodians and investment providers
  • Prepare client meeting materials, investment reviews, and retirement plan review presentations
  • Support onboarding and implementation of new retirement plans
  • Maintain accurate client records and documentation in CRM systems
  • Help identify opportunities to strengthen client relationships and improve the client experience
  • Play a vital role in the sales, plan design and implementation process including participating in finalist presentations
  • Consult with clients and prospects on mergers and acquisitions
  • Attend networking events to build relationships and identify sales opportunities
  • Optimize client portfolios by conducting thorough investment analysis and making data-driven recommendations for change when necessary
  • Collaborate with team members, platform providers, TPA partners and auditors to present plan document reviews, investment reviews and RFP
  • Benchmarking Cost Analysis
  • Stay informed on industry trends, retirement plan regulations, and compliance updates

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ree preferred
  • FINRA Series 6 or 7 license required
  • FINRA Series 63 or 66 license preferred
  • Clean compliance, credit and U4 history required
  • 3 to 5+ years retirement plan experience required, specifically with 401(k) and/or 403(b) plans, including fiduciary responsibilities (3(21) and 3(38) fiduciary services)
  • Strong understanding of retirement plan operations, investments and fiduciary concepts
  • Knowledge of ERISA, DOL and FINRA rules and regulations
  • Excellent communication and relationship management skills
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ities
  • Demonstrated ability to work effectively in a team environment and independently
  • Ability to build strong relationships with clients and internal teams
  • Ability to manage competing priorities in a fast paced environment with strong attention to detail
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and CRM systems

Benefits

  • Competitive salary commensurate with experience
  • Bonus: discretionary, typically around 10% of salary
  • 3% safe harbor annual 401(k) contribution
  • Profit Sharing Plan
  • 100% employer paid Health, Dental and AD&D Insurance
  • Group voluntary Vision, Life and Disability Insurance
  • Paid Time Off
